Advanced Infrastructure Technologies has developed a proprietary composite arch tube system for bridge construction as a more cost-efficient and durable alternative to traditional building methods. Their system uses inflatable composite tubes that are bent on-site to form arches which are then filled with concrete. This eliminates the need for heavy transportation, rebar, and temporary formwork. They have completed the first bridge using this system in Pittsfield, ME and have a pipeline of 16 future bridge projects. Management aims to address the large problem of deficient bridges in the U.S. infrastructure through lower lifecycle costs and a more resilient design.
